Does Petco offer affordable spay/neuter and microchip services?

Do you do "low cost" spay & neuter? What about microchip? What are the fees for both services? Thank you.

Spay and neuter services are not offered at vaccination clinics. The microchip price is $15 at most Petco/Vetco locations. You can find additional pricing information here: https://www.vetcoclinics.com/services-and-clinics/vaccination-packages-and-prices/

    The Vetco clinics at PetCo don’t do neutering surgery. They do healthy pet vaccinations, deworming and can test him for feline leukemia and feline aids. They can also insert a microchip.
